Angry Electrical Gremlins Ate My Truck

After about 4 months of working on my junkyard bought Toyota I've got it running, not well but it moves. Now I've gotten to the lights part of my adventure. I replaced all the bulbs in the tails and resoldered and heat shrinked all things that I deemed necessary but I've still got issues. My Hazard lights work awesome, all 4, but I can't get a SINGLE turn signal to fire up. I also have rear tail markers but no brakelights. Anyone have any ideas on where I should begin my electrical quest to slay the gremlins taking over my truck?:cry:

You could change the flashers. Probable culprit would be your turn signal switch. There could also be a loose conection somewhere. Inspect the fuse box at the signal fuse (if there's fire on both side of fuse then it is a switch problem. If there's no fire, then there's a loose conection in the system). Start checking for power at various points along the wires, I know its tedious, but it will help narrow it down quicker the guessing.

Check all your grounds, make sure you have everything grounded properly.
